Output e66194db44b8b64388758615e6209037d8b9b52f4e4f53b22a1510a1cb7f2126:3

value
25522864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4179135d69139a065ea0117144a26c946f0fc312 OP_EQUAL
address
MDsMCP8drDvjBdzeoT3HhqcfftMm2Y3ngp
transaction
e66194db44b8b64388758615e6209037d8b9b52f4e4f53b22a1510a1cb7f2126
spent
true